The Story Behind the Hyundai i30
Before diving into generations, it helps to understand the mindset behind the car.
The Hyundai Motor Company designed the i30 primarily for the European market. That means tighter handling, refined interiors, and a focus on everyday usability rather than pure power.
Think of it as Hyundai saying: “We can play the European game—and play it well.”

First Generation (2007–2012): The Foundation Years
A Fresh Start for Hyundai
The first-generation i30 (FD) marked a turning point. Before this, Hyundai was often seen as a budget brand. This car changed that narrative.
Key Highlights
- Designed in Europe (Germany)
- Solid build quality improvement
- Practical interior space
- Competitive pricing
Design Philosophy: Simple but Smart
This wasn’t a bold design—it was safe, clean, and functional.
Exterior Traits
- Rounded edges
- Conservative front grille
- Compact hatchback proportions
Interior Feel
- Straightforward dashboard layout
- Durable materials (not luxurious, but reliable)
Engine Options and Performance
The first-gen i30 focused more on efficiency than excitement.
Common Engines
- 1.4L petrol
- 1.6L petrol
- 1.6 CRDi diesel
- 2.0L petrol (in some markets)
It wasn’t thrilling—but it was dependable.
What We Learned From Gen 1
This generation proved one thing clearly:
Hyundai could compete—and not just on price.
Second Generation (2012–2017): The Confidence Boost
A Bold Step Forward
With the GD generation, Hyundai stopped playing safe and started playing smart.
Design Revolution: Fluidic Sculpture
Suddenly, the i30 looked… stylish.
Visual Changes
- Sharper headlights
- Sleeker body lines
- More dynamic stance
It went from “just practical” to “actually attractive.”

Third Generation (2017–Present): The Maturity Phase
Entering the Big League
With the PD generation, the i30 matured into a serious competitor against giants like the VW Golf.
Design: Clean, Modern, Confident
No more overdesign—just clean lines and a premium feel.
Exterior Highlights
- Cascading grille
- LED lighting
- Sportier stance
The cabin feels like a step above its class.
Key Features
- Floating touchscreen
- Digital displays
- Improved sound insulation
Performance Variants: Enter the N Line
This is where things get interesting.
Sporty Versions
- i30 N Line (mild performance)
- i30 N (full performance hatch)
The i30 suddenly had attitude.
Technology and Safety Upgrades
Modern drivers expect tech—and Hyundai delivered.
Tech Features
- Apple CarPlay & Android Auto
- Lane-keeping assist
- Adaptive cruise control
Facelift Updates: Keeping It Fresh
Even within this generation, Hyundai refined the car further.
Updates Included
- Mild hybrid engines
- Updated infotainment
- Sharper styling tweaks
Gen 3 Summary
This generation feels like the i30 finally saying:
“We’re not catching up anymore—we’re competing.”
Hyundai i30 Generations Comparison Table
Quick Overview
| Generation | Years | Key Focus |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gen 1 | 2007–2012 | Reliability & value | Budget buyers |
| Gen 2 | 2012–2017 | Style & refinement | Balanced drivers |
| Gen 3 | 2017–Now | Tech & performance | Modern enthusiasts |

Common Problems Across Generations
Let’s be honest—no car is perfect.
Known Issues
- Diesel DPF problems (older models)
- Suspension wear (Gen 1)
- Electrical quirks (early Gen 2)
But overall? The i30 has a solid reputation.
